How far is San Diego, CA, from Cleveland, OH?

The distance between Cleveland (Cleveland Hopkins International Airport) and San Diego (San Diego International Airport) is 2027 miles / 3261 kilometers / 1761 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Cleveland (CLE) to San Diego (SAN) is 2398 miles / 3859 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 42 hours 19 minutes.

Distance from Cleveland to San Diego

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Cleveland to San Diego.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 2026.523 miles
  • 3261.373 kilometers
  • 1761.000 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 2022.558 miles
  • 3254.992 kilometers
  • 1757.555 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).

How long does it take to fly from Cleveland to San Diego?

The estimated flight time from Cleveland Hopkins International Airport to San Diego International Airport is 4 hours and 20 minutes.

Flight carbon footprint between Cleveland Hopkins International Airport (CLE) and San Diego International Airport (SAN)

On average, flying from Cleveland to San Diego generates about 221 kg of CO2 per passenger, and 221 kilograms equals 486 pounds (lbs). The figures are estimates and include only the CO2 generated by burning jet fuel.
